Web31 aug. 2024 · Calculate Productivity By dividing the number of products produced by the man-hours involved, you calculate the average production rate. As an example, if your employees produced 800 units in the 200 total man-hours during the week, divide 800 by 200 to calculate 4 units per man-hour. How do you calculate the rate of formation in …
